如果满足条件,则复制和粘贴数据

时间:2019-10-29 07:20:31

标签: excel vba

我是excel vba的新手。我需要将B3:D3中的数据复制到A6:C6中。该代码必须检查A6:C6中的数据。如果存在现有值,则必须将其复制到下面的单元格中,即A7:C7。

enter image description here

Sub CopyandPaste()

Dim lrow As Integer
Sheets("Sheet1").Range("B3:D3").Copy 'Cell to copy
lrow = 100 'End row
For i = 6 To 100 'Loop from row 6 to 100
If Cells(i, 1) = "" Then 'If cell is empty then paste new value
Sheets("Sheet1").Range(Cells(i, 1)).PasteSpecial xlPasteValues
End If
Next i
End Sub

0 个答案:

没有答案